This year’s Cartoon Business, held for the first time in Brussels, featured numerous panels centered around analytics and big data. However, Martin Juza, CEO of Prague-based production company Krutart, delivered an inspiring presentation that offered a captivating perspective on a smaller scale.
Before venturing into business, Juza started his career as a filmmaker and an artist and worked as a freelance commercial director / motion designer. In 2014, after several years of struggling to get funding for his own projects, he turned the tables and co-founded Krutart with Filip Veselý and Klára Jůzova.
Since then, the company has grown and produced short films, documentaries, commercials and tv series including Kosmix in 2020, a hit on Czech Television and now distributed worldwide by the French sales agent Dandelooo.
At Cartoon Business, Juza offered a glimpse of Krutart’s diversified strategy: a three-way revenue stream divided between regular animated productions, commissions for museums and sales for immersive media, with its own in-house sales department for immersive media projects and an editorial line with a planned release of one film per year.
Juza recalled:
From the beginning, there was a need to create a sense of togetherness. From the outset, my two co-founders and I have held strategic meetings every two weeks. Krutart launched with a team of five or six people from the start. Surrounding yourself with people who can inspire and propel you forward is crucial, and I believe that our emphasis on collaboration has been a significant factor in our growth.
As a former director, Juza went on to explain how he is now channelling his creativity into Krutart’s business strategy.
I think it all comes down to visualization. As a director, you are thinking all the time and imagining what your film will look like. As a CEO, I just changed the subject of this imagination. This still is a creative process, only I am now applying it to projects, business units or business models. I mean, spreadsheets are the most creative tools in the world! But seriously, it’s a tool of shaping the future in some way, because when you go into the numbers and look at every item in a budget, you really are looking at people, energy, only from a different perspective.
Krutart is currently working on season 2 of Kosmix, on a feature film from the same universe scheduled for 2027, and news IP’s.
